ROLE AND RESPONSIBILITIES
The CEI Inspector II - IV serves as a senior-level field inspector for TxDOT construction projects. This role provides advanced inspection, documentation, and compliance oversight on complex roadway and bridge projects. The Inspector IV communicates effectively with the CEI Project Manager and TxDOT Project Manager, leads and manages inspection staff, and supports project execution through proactive coordination and meeting management. In this capacity, the successful candidate will be responsible for the following:
- Perform inspection of roadway, bridge, drainage, earthwork, concrete, asphalt, retaining walls, and traffic control operations.
- Ensure all work complies with TxDOT Standard Specifications, contract plans, and special provisions.
- Communicate clearly and consistently with the CEI Project Manager and TxDOT Project Manager regarding progress, risks, and required decisions.
- (If an Inspector IV) Lead, direct, and manage Inspector II–III staff, including daily assignments, field coordination, and mentoring.
- Run and facilitate project meetings, including pre-activity, coordination, and construction meetings as assigned.
- Review contractor operations and verify materials placement, testing, and quality control activities.
- Prepare and audits accurate Daily Work Reports (DWRs), pay quantities, diaries, and photo documentation using SiteManager.
- Monitor and document work zone traffic control and TMUTCD compliance.
- Support with RFI, Submittals reviews, estimates, change orders, audits, and project closeout.
- Other duties as assigned.
BASIC QUALIFICATIONS
- High school diploma or GED required.
- 4 - 10+ years of TxDOT or TxDOT-equivalent construction inspection experience, including complex roadway and/or bridge projects.
- Extensive experience on TxDOT contracts.
- Proven ability to lead inspection teams, manage inspectors, and represent the CEI firm in meetings with TxDOT.
- Strong working knowledge of TxDOT specifications, TMUTCD, and documentation standards.
- Proficiency with SiteManager, Proficiency in Microsoft 365, including core Office applications and cloud-based collaboration tools.

Get Access To All JobsTips for Finding Visa Sponsorship as a Construction Engineer
Major Engineering Firms Sponsor at the Highest Volume
Bechtel, Fluor, AECOM, Jacobs, Turner, and Skanska sponsor for construction engineers on commercial, industrial, and infrastructure projects nationwide. These firms manage CHIPS Act fab construction, data center campuses, and federal infrastructure requiring large engineering teams.
Semiconductor Fab and Data Center Construction Creates Urgent Demand
Intel, TSMC, Samsung, Amazon, Google, and Microsoft are building facilities worth hundreds of billions, creating thousands of construction engineering positions. Project timelines are aggressive and employers sponsor readily when domestic recruitment fails.
PE Licensure Significantly Strengthens Your Profile
Professional Engineer licensure demonstrates that you meet U.S. engineering practice standards and can stamp construction documents. PE-licensed construction engineers earn 12 to 18% more and qualify for lead and principal engineer roles.
TN Engineer Is the Fastest Path for USMCA Citizens
The Engineer category on the USMCA treaty list covers construction engineering for Canadian and Mexican citizens with engineering degrees. Same-day border approval, no lottery, no cap, and three-year renewable terms.
L-1 Transfers From International Project Sites Are Common
Bechtel, Fluor, Skanska, Balfour Beatty, and Bouygues operate construction projects globally and transfer engineers on L-1 visa from international sites. Build one year of strong technical delivery on a major project before requesting transfer.
Federal Infrastructure Investment Sustains Long-Term Demand
The Infrastructure Investment and Jobs Act funds highway, bridge, rail, water, and broadband construction for the next decade. These federally funded projects require licensed construction engineers and create sustained sponsorship demand beyond the current cycle.
Frequently Asked Questions
Do companies sponsor H-1B visas for Construction Engineers?
Yes, extensively. Construction engineering requires civil or structural engineering degrees, making H-1B visa classification automatic. Bechtel, Fluor, AECOM, Turner, and dozens of firms sponsor routinely.
What is the typical salary for sponsored Construction Engineer roles?
Construction engineers earn $70,000 to $100,000. Senior construction engineers earn $95,000 to $135,000. Lead engineers on megaprojects earn $120,000 to $170,000.
What qualifications strengthen a Construction Engineer's sponsorship case?
A civil, structural, or construction engineering degree is required. PE licensure demonstrates U.S. practice standards and strengthens H-1B petitions. Experience with BIM, structural analysis software, and construction management platforms differentiates you from entry-level candidates.

Which construction sectors have the best sponsorship prospects?
Semiconductor fab construction under CHIPS Act has the most acute demand. Data center megaprojects for hyperscale operators sponsor urgently. Federal infrastructure projects funded by IIJA provide long-term demand.
What is the career progression for a sponsored Construction Engineer?
The path moves from construction engineer to senior engineer to lead engineer to project manager to construction director. Project managers at major firms earn $115,000 to $185,000. Directors earn $160,000 to $250,000.
